Sydney, NSW — New South Wales households and businesses considering battery storage are set to benefit from significant expansions to the state’s Peak Demand Reduction Scheme (PDRS). Effective July 1, 2026, and with further changes coming on September 1, 2026, the PDRS now offers an upfront incentive of up to AUD$1,500 for eligible batteries connected to a Virtual Power Plant (VPP), with eligibility extending to apartment buildings and larger commercial systems.
This move by the NSW government aims to accelerate the deployment of battery storage across the state, helping to stabilise the grid during peak demand periods and reduce reliance on traditional energy sources. The expanded PDRS incentive stacks directly with the existing Federal Cheaper Home Batteries Program, offering a more compelling financial case for Australians to invest in energy storage.
What is the NSW Peak Demand Reduction Scheme (PDRS)?
The PDRS is a state-based initiative designed to incentivise consumers to reduce electricity demand during critical peak periods. By connecting a home battery system to a VPP, households and businesses allow their stored energy to be dispatched back to the grid when demand is high. In return, participants receive an upfront financial incentive, rather than a bill credit or future payment.
“The PDRS rewards you for helping cut electricity demand at peak times. For eligible NSW batteries connected to a VPP, this incentive is delivered as an upfront payment of up to $1,500.”
This mechanism helps to smooth out electricity demand, reducing strain on network infrastructure and potentially lowering wholesale electricity prices for all consumers. The scheme has been a key component of NSW’s strategy to build a more resilient and renewable-powered energy system.
Key Changes from July 1, 2026
As of July 1, 2026, the PDRS expanded its eligibility criteria to include battery systems with a total capacity of up to 50 kWh. Previously, the scheme had tighter limits, meaning many larger residential or small commercial systems were excluded. This expansion acknowledges the growing trend towards larger home battery installations and the increasing energy demands of modern Australian households, particularly those with electric vehicles (EVs) or high energy consumption.
For homeowners, this means a wider range of battery models and capacities can now qualify for the state rebate, offering greater flexibility in system design. Whether you’re upgrading an existing solar setup or installing a new integrated system, the expanded capacity limits ensure more installations can access this valuable incentive.
September 2026: A Game-Changer for Apartments and Businesses
The most significant expansion of the PDRS is slated for September 1, 2026. From this date, the scheme will extend eligibility to two previously excluded groups: apartment buildings and larger commercial and industrial energy users.
This marks the first time apartment residents in NSW will be able to access a state battery rebate. Group battery storage systems installed within strata schemes or multi-dwelling units can now qualify for the PDRS incentive, which can significantly reduce the upfront cost of shared energy storage infrastructure. This is crucial for improving energy independence and reducing common area electricity bills in high-density living environments.
Furthermore, the scheme will now cover commercial and industrial battery systems up to 30 MWh. This substantial increase in capacity eligibility is expected to dramatically alter the financial case for businesses with significant energy costs to invest in large-scale battery storage, allowing them to better manage their energy consumption, participate in demand response, and potentially generate revenue through VPPs.
Stacking Your Savings: PDRS and Federal Rebates
The NSW PDRS incentive is entirely separate from, and stacks with, the Federal Cheaper Home Batteries Program. This means eligible NSW homeowners can claim both the federal rebate and the PDRS VPP incentive on the same battery installation, leading to substantial upfront savings.
The Federal Cheaper Home Batteries Program, which launched in July 2025 and saw changes in May 2026, provides an upfront discount on eligible battery systems. As of July 2026, this federal rebate is approximately AUD$252 per usable kWh for the first 14 kWh of battery capacity, tapering for larger systems.
For example, a typical 10 kWh home battery could receive around AUD$2,520 from the federal rebate. When combined with the AUD$1,500 PDRS incentive, the total upfront savings could reach approximately AUD$4,020. This significantly reduces the net cost of installing a home battery system, making it more accessible to a broader range of consumers. The Role of Virtual Power Plants (VPPs)
To access the PDRS incentive, your battery must be connected to an eligible Virtual Power Plant (VPP). A VPP aggregates distributed energy resources, such as home batteries and rooftop solar, allowing them to act as a single, larger power plant. This collective capacity can then be used by the grid operator or an energy retailer to provide services like demand response or grid stabilisation.
Connecting to a VPP is typically a software and account registration process, not a physical modification to your battery. Most VPP programs offer flexibility with no lock-in contracts, meaning you retain control over your system. Participating in a VPP not only unlocks the PDRS incentive but can also provide ongoing financial benefits, with some programs offering additional payments for grid services.
Despite the clear financial benefits, a recent ACCC report highlighted that only 24% of Australian households with solar and battery systems currently participate in a VPP, even though VPP participants typically see greater savings on their electricity bills. This suggests a significant untapped potential for consumers to further reduce their energy costs and contribute to grid stability.
Compatible Battery Brands and Next Steps
Many leading battery brands are compatible with VPP programs in NSW. These often include models from manufacturers such as Sungrow, GoodWe, Sigenergy, and FoxESS. When obtaining a quote for a battery system, it is crucial to confirm its VPP compatibility with your installer and chosen VPP provider.
